🇧🇮 Burundi Internationaler Tourismus, Einnahmen
Burundi Internationaler Tourismus, Einnahmen was $3.70M in 2011, up 76.2% from 2010, according to World Bank data. The 10-year average is $1.95M. Historical data available from 1995 to 2011 (17 data points). The all-time high was $3.70M in 2011.
Source: World Bank World Development Indicators • 1995–2011 • 17 data points • Private Sector

About this Indicator
International tourism receipts are expenditures by international inbound visitors, including payments to national carriers for international transport. These receipts include any other prepayment made for goods or services received in the destination country. They also may include receipts from same-day visitors, except when these are important enough to justify separate classification. For some countries they do not include receipts for passenger transport items.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
Historical Data Table
| Year | Value |
|---|---|
| 2011 | $3.70M |
| 2010 | $2.10M |
| 2009 | $1.70M |
| 2008 | $1.60M |
| 2007 | $2.30M |
| 2006 | $1.60M |
| 2005 | $1.90M |
| 2004 | $1.80M |
| 2003 | $1.20M |
| 2002 | $1.60M |
